Blue Wolf Capital appoints lead operating partner

Blue Wolf Capital Partners has appointed Anne Bailey as Lead Operating Partner, strengthening its senior leadership team as the private equity firm continues to focus on operational value creation across its healthcare and industrial portfolio.

Bailey, who joined Blue Wolf in 2024, will now lead the firm’s team of operating partners, working closely with portfolio company management teams to support operational improvements and drive investment performance. She succeeds George Judd, who has held the position since 2018 and will remain with the firm as an operating partner.

Bailey brings nearly three decades of leadership experience spanning healthcare, consumer products, aerospace and defence. During her time at Blue Wolf, she has worked with portfolio companies on strategic and operational initiatives aimed at accelerating growth and enhancing long-term value creation.

Commenting on the appointment, Blue Wolf managing partner Jeremy Kogler said Bailey had quickly established herself as a trusted adviser to both the firm’s investment professionals and portfolio company executives, citing her operational expertise and experience managing businesses through complex challenges.

Before joining Blue Wolf, Bailey served as president of Modivcare Home, where she led a business generating approximately $900 million in annual revenue and managed a workforce of more than 18,000 employees. Earlier in her career, she held senior leadership positions at DaVita and Bain & Company, advising organisations across the healthcare, consumer products and education sectors.

Bailey said her experience at Blue Wolf had demonstrated the benefits of the firm’s collaborative operating model and expressed her commitment to building on that approach in her expanded leadership role.

In addition to her executive experience, Bailey has served on the boards of several community and advocacy organisations, including the Chronic Disease Coalition, CU Denver Business School, City Year Denver, Amp the Cause and Access Opportunity.

Blue Wolf Capital specialises in middle-market private equity investments in the healthcare and industrial sectors, with a strategy centred on operational transformation and long-term value creation. The firm works alongside portfolio company management teams to improve performance through strategic, operational and organisational initiatives.
